Albanvale vs Terang: what the numbers say

Over the past year house prices moved +10.4% in Albanvale and +0.7% in Terang (an estimate), so recent momentum favours Albanvale, although both suburbs recorded growth.

Rental vacancy is 0.6% in Terang and 0.6% in Albanvale, so landlords in Terang face less competition for tenants. Anything under 2% is generally read as a tight market where tenants compete for homes.

Albanvale is the bigger suburb, with a population of 5,641 against 2,254, roughly 2.5 times the size of Terang; a larger suburb usually means a deeper pool of buyers and tenants.
